The Ministry of Corporate Affairs (MCA) initiated adjudication proceedings against M/s. Ajay Nidhi Limited for failing to comply with Rule 14(6) of the Companies (Prospectus and Allotment of Securities) Rules, 2014. The company, registered under the Companies Act, 2013, did not include essential details such as the Permanent Account Number (PAN), email ID, and class of security held in the list submitted with Form PAS-3 for allotment of securities. Despite being notified of the violation, the company and its directors did not respond to the adjudication notice. Consequently, a hearing was conducted, and it was determined that the violation was not intentional. However, due to non-compliance, the Registrar of Companies, Chennai, acting as the Adjudicating Officer, imposed a penalty of ₹10,000 on the company and an additional ₹10,000 on the Managing Director, Shri Kamalchand. The total penalty amounts to ₹20,000, which must be paid within 90 days. Failure to comply with this order may result in further fines and potential imprisonment for the responsible officers. The company has the right to appeal this decision within 60 days.

4. Section/Rule and Penal Provision as per Companies Act, 2013

Rule 14(6) of the Companies (Prospectus and Allotment of Securities) Rules, 2014:•

Private placement.

(6) A return of allotment of securities under section 42 shall be filed with the Registrar within fifteen days of allotment’ in Form PAS-3 and with the fee as provided in the Companies (Registration offices and Fees) Rules, 2014 along with a complete list of all the allottees containing-

(i) the full name, address, permanent Account Number and E-mail ID of such security holder;

(ii) the class of security held;

(iii) the date of allotment of security;

(iv) the number of securities herd, nominal value and amount paid on such securities; and particulars of consideration received if tire securities were issued for consideration other than cash.

Section 42 Offer or Invitation for Subscription of Securities on Private Placement.

(1) A company may, subject to the provisions of this section, make a private placement of securities.

(2) A private placement shall be made only to a select group of persons who have been identified by the Board (herein referred to as “identified persons”), whose number shall not exceed fifty or such higher number as may be prescribed [excluding the qualified institutional buyers and employees of the company being offered securities under a scheme of employees stock option in terms of provisions of clause (b) of sub-section (1) of section 62, in a financial year subject to such conditions as may be prescribed.

Section 450. Punishment where no specific penalty or punishment is provided.

If a company or any officer of a company or any other person contravenes any of the provisions of this Act or the rules made thereunder, or any condition, limitation or restriction subject to which any approval, sanction, consent, confirmation, recognition, direction or exemption in relation to any matter has been accorded, given or granted, and for which no penalty or punishment is provided elsewhere in this Act, the company and every officer of the company who is in default or such other person shall be liable to a penalty of ten thousand rupees, and in case of continuing contravention, with a further penalty of one thousand rupees for each day after the first during which the contravention continues, subject to a maximum of two lakh rupees in case of a company and fifty thousand rupees in case of an officer who is in default or any other person.

5. Issue of Adjudication Notice:

The Ministry vide letter dated 09.06.2023 rejected the form NDH-4 (Form for filing application for declaration as Nidhi and for updation of Status by Nidhi) filed by the company M/s. Ajay Nidhi Limited (vide SRN: R68588243 Dt 24.12.2020) wherein it was mentioned that ” the company has also violated Rule 14(6) of the Companies (Prospectus and Allotment of Securities) Rules, 2014 which reads as follows:

A return of allotment of securities under section 42 shall be filed with the Registrar within fifteen days of allotment in Form PAS-3 and with the fee as provided in the Companies (Registration offices and Fees) Rules, 2014 along with a complete list of all th,“, allottees containing-

(i) the full name, address, permanent Account Number and E-mail ID of such security holder;

(ii) the class of security held;

(iii) the date of allotment of security ;

(iv) the number of securities herd, nominal value and amount paid on such securities; and particulars of consideration received if tire securities were issued for consideration other than cash.

After that the Adjudicating Authority had issued Adjudication Notice No. ROC/CHN/Adj/Ajay/2023 dt 31.08.2023 to the company.

6. Reply of Company and Directors for Adjudication Notice issued:

No reply has been received from the company and its directors.

7. Adjudication Hearing:

Since no reply has been received from the company and its directors for the Adjudication notice dated 31.08.2023, the Adjudicating Authority has issued notice of hearing dated 04.03.2024 by fixing the hearing on 12.03.2024 at 11:15 AM. Pursuant to the notice dated 04.03.2024, Shri. Dixith Kumar, CS appeared before the Adjudicating Authority on behalf of the Company and its Managing Director on 12.03.2024 and made submissions that the violation may be adjudicated as it is not intentional.

8. Analysis of Non-compliance of Rule 12(2) of the Companies (Prospectus and Allotment of Securities) Rules, 2014:

The company being a Nidhi company does not fall under the definition of small company as per provision of section 2(85) of the companies Act, 2013. Therefore, of imposing the provision lesser penalty as per section 446(b) shall not be applicable in this case.

A list of allottees is attached along with form PAS -3 filed (vide SRN: 839363080 dt 21.05.2020) by the company, the Permanent Account Number, Email id of security holder and the class of security held are not mentioned in the list as required under Rule 14(6) of the Companies Prospectus and Allotment of Securities), Rules, 2014.

9. Decision:

Having considered the facts and circumstances of the case and after taking into account it is concluded that the company and directors have violated Rule 14(6) of (Companies Prospectus and Allotment of Securities), Rules, 2014.

Accordingly, I am inclined to impose a penalty as prescribed under Section 450 of the Companies Act, 2013. The details of the penalty imposed on the Company and Officers in default are shown in the table given below:

Therefore, in view of the above said violation, in exercise of the powers vested to the undersigned under Section 454(1) & (3) of the Companies Act, 2013 a penalty of Rs.10,000/- (Rupees Ten thousand) is imposed on the Company and Rs.10,000/- (Rupees ten Thousand) is imposed on the Officer in default as mentioned above. Totally Rs.20,000/- (Rupees Twenty Thousand) as penalty amount for violation of Rule 14(6) of the Companies (Prospectus and Allotment of Securities), Rules, 2014.

10. The said amount of penalty shall be paid through online by using the websit… mca.gov.in(Misc. head) within 90 days of receipt of this order, and intimate this office with proof of penalty paid.

11. Whereas Appeal against this order may be filed with the Regional Director (SR), Ministry of Corporate Affairs, 5th Floor, Shastri Bhavan, 26 Haddows Road, Chennai-600006, Tamil Nadu within a period of sixty days from the date of receipt of this order, in Form ADJ [available on Ministry website www.mca.gov.in] setting forth the grounds of appeal and shall be accompanied by a certified copy of this order. [Section 454(5) & 454(6) of the Act read with Companies (Adjudicating of Penalties) Rules, 2014].

12. Your attention is also invited to section 454(8) of the Act in the event of non-compliance of this order, “(8)(i) Where company fails to comply with the order made under sub­section (3) or sub-section (7), as the case may be within a period of ninety days from the date of the receipt of the copy of the order, the company shall be punishable with fine which shall not be less than twenty five thousand rupees but which may extend to five lakh rupees.

13. Where an officer of a company or any other person who is in default fails to comply with the order made under sub-section (3) or sub-section (7), as the case may be within a period of ninety days from the date of the receipt of the copy of the order, such officer shall be punishable with imprisonment which may extend to six months or with fine which shall not be less than twenty-five thousand rupees but which may extend to one lakh rupees, or with both.”
